logo

Output 56c87b60c90e382cda267c99314b8904cf4dfa3b3ee9a78e60e5bc15077de633:1

value
16363510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88b9ee2598d162e5ae16e9be9d4030ed3328f20c OP_EQUALVERIFY OP_CHECKSIG
address
1DTwdkVssZZA3pn3rkgCQsQJ35YXYaLA9q
transaction
56c87b60c90e382cda267c99314b8904cf4dfa3b3ee9a78e60e5bc15077de633